Louny - Architect Josef Pleskot will prepare a project in Louny to commemorate the painter and native of Louny, Zdeněk Sýkora. The small square in front of the Vrchlického Theater will take the form of a curtain designed by Sýkora. The councilors approved an exception to the rules for public procurement and a licensing agreement with Lenka Sýkorová, the heir of the copyright.


Following this, the project documentation will be processed. "We were waiting for the councilors' decision because granting an exception is not entirely common," Jiří Jiroutek from the Sýkora 2020 association, which aims to commemorate the native by 2020 when he would celebrate his hundredth birthday, told ČTK today. "The implementation of Sýkora's motif on the piazzetta is tied to the project of architect Pleskot; we wanted him to handle it specifically. If there were to be a tender, someone else could win the contract, then the implementation would lose its meaning," Jiroutek explained.


Some criticized the granting of the exception. It ultimately passed with seventeen votes, two councilors were against, and six abstained. The total costs are estimated at 9.47 million crowns, of which the project documentation will cost 1.21 million crowns, and the fee for granting the license is one million crowns. "The piazzetta is basically a sidewalk, and the price that someone would project it for a million crowns seems really exaggerated to me," said councilor Stanislav Rybák (KSČM), who also disapproved of granting an exception to the public procurement rules.


According to Michal Kučera (TOP 09), the implementation is financially sustainable for Louny. The association has also offered to share in co-financing and to seek funds from various sources. "Louny has one enormous advantage; they have something to build upon, on specific works of art. If something is to remain here for future generations, this is it," said Kučera.


The proposal to commemorate the world pioneer in the use of computers in preparing artworks was presented to the councilors before the vote by Pleskot. Sýkora created a unique fireproof curtain for the Louny theater in 1962, which disappeared during the renovation of the building in 2002. It is recalled by a large-format photograph in the theater's entrance hall. "When I saw the curtain design, it immediately struck me that it is the proportion of a work that could be imprinted onto the piazzetta almost without corrections," Pleskot stated. According to him, the black and white mosaic, which will replace the existing concrete tiles, could be made from contemporary recycled materials. "Which would be an interesting experiment," added Pleskot, who emphasized that it would be an honor for him to create a work for Louny and for Sýkora.


The Sýkora 2020 association hopes that the realization of the project will, among other things, increase the city's visitor numbers. "People from the wider area are interested in the project, not just artists," Jiroutek said. "It will definitely be something that elevates Louny," he added.
